CALICO CAT

    Originally, Calico referred to a fabric printed with a pattern of small flowers. Later, Calico was used to describe a multi-colored cat. The Calico cat is thought to bring good luck and fortune to the homes and families that adopt them. In the 1870s, Calico cats were named the official symbol of fortune in Japan.
